摘要

We revealed specific features of optimal control for through induction heating of large scale discontinuous bodies and solved the problem of optimal control for their heating. By discontinuous bodies, objects of induction heating we mean compound or formed bodies that have contact thermal resistances in the direction of the largest value of the temperature gradient. Among these bodies are, for example, rolls of metal sheet, bundles of standardized metal, some types of machining attachments (including those that provide isothermal die forging under conditions of superplasticity or production of parts made of polymer composite materials) and also assemblies and units of machines and mechanisms.
